Poland's EU Presidency: Prioritizing Security and Defense

Poland's 2025 EU Presidency, starting in January, will prioritize energy security, defense, and economic stability, aiming to address challenges from the war in Ukraine and global shifts, with a planned increase in defense spending and innovative funding solutions.
